Record Number of College-Aged Voters Anticipated for Mid-Term Elections
11/2/2006

According to a November 2, 2006 Inside Higher Ed article, a recent poll conducted by Harvard University's Institute of Politics indicates that nearly one-third of 18- to 24-year-olds surveyed plan to vote on November 7th. Historically, voters in this same age bracket have had a roughly 21% turnout at mid-term elections. The survey included college students and young adults who are not attending college. Young adults have demonstrated increased levels of social engagement, including volunteerism and political awareness/involvement, since the events of September 11, 2001.
